From the fore oing description, taken in. connection with t 1e accompanying drawing, theadvantage of the construction and. operation of the device shown will be readily understood by those skilled in the art to which the invention pertains; and while'I have described the principle of'operation, together with the device which I now consider to be the best embodiment thereof, I desire to have it understood that the device shown is merely illustrative and that such changes may be made when desired as are within the scope of the appended claims.
Having thus described my invention, I claim as new and desire to secure by Letters Patent: 4
' 1. In a crusher,a frame; a jaw carried by the frame; a lever mounted to oscillate in the frame; a jaw carried by the lever; a crank shaft in the frame; a pitman on the crank; a toggle intermediate the pitman and the lever; a second toggle on the other side of the pitman associated with the frame; and means positioned between the said second toggle and the pitman adapted to maintain said lever immovable, while the pitman moves, when an object of high resistance enters between the crushing jaws.
2. In a crusher,frame; a jaw carried by the frame; a lever mounted to oscillate in the frame; a jaw. carried by the lover; a crank shaft in the frame; a pitman on the crank; a toggle intermediate the pitman and the lever; a second toggle on the other side of the pitman associted with the frame; means between the pitman and said last mentioned toggle including resilient members whereby said lever is adapted to remain immovable, while the pitman moves, when an object of high resistance enters between the crushing jaws.
. 3. In a crusher,a frame; a crushing jaw in the frame; a lever mounted to oscillate in' the frame; a jaw in the lever; a pitman in the frame; means for actuating the pit man; a toggle between the pitman and the lever;,a' second toggle on the opposite side of the pitman associated with the frame; an
arm mounted to oscillate on the pitman engaging said second toggle; and resilient means normally preventing the oscillation of said arm .on the pitman, the resistance of said resilient means being such as to permit the lever to remain immovable, while the pit man moves, when an object of high resistance enters between the jaws.
4. In a crusher,a frame; a jaw in said frame; a lever mounted to oscillate in the frame; a jaw carried by the lever; means for oscillating the lever; and means associated with said means for oscillating the lever, positioned exteriorly of said lever, whereby the said lever remains immovable during the movement of said means for oscillating the lever when an object of high resistanceienaters between the jaws.
